In Applied Engineering and Machining (Machine Shop), you will gain the skills to invent, design, create, and build the high-tech precision parts and tools used worldwide in everyday products. Students learn to use advanced computer-controlled technology to manufacture precise steel, aluminum, and plastic components. Machine Shop graduates enter the workforce proficient in programming and controlling industrial CNC machines to produce products from engineering blueprints and specifications.
